WebAs nouns the difference between boast and boost is that boast is a brag, a loud positive appraisal of oneself while boost is a push from behind, as to one who is endeavoring to climb; help. As verbs the difference between boast and boost is that boast is to brag; to talk loudly in praise of oneself while boost is to lift or push from behind (one who is …
